  • Many animals display brilliant colors thanks to the precise formation of guanine crystals within specialized organelles. Here, the authors demonstrate that dynamic pH shifts orchestrate this process: an initially acidic lumen stabilizes amorphous, protonated guanine and subsequent alkalinization triggers its crystallization.

  • Organisms regulate biogenic crystal properties for various functions. Here the authors reveal the genetic and biochemical control of crystal morphogenesis in zebrafish iridophores, showing that the chemical composition, influenced by enzyme expression, determines crystal morphology and functionality.

  • Silica formation in diatoms is of interest for a range of different subjects from biomimetics to oceanography. Here the authors study the formation of silicified extensions in diatoms and find that unlike cell wall elements, that form in the cytoplasm, the extensions have a different formation mechanism outside the cytoplasm.
